10 Health Benefits of Bottle Gourd (Doodhi, Lauki)

 

Talking about bottle gourd (doodhi, lauki), it’s known to be a dietitian’s favourite. The reason is quite clear. This versatile vegetable possess umpteen health benefits and can be safely added to most menus – be it diabetes, weight loss, healthy heart, kidney disease, liver disease, pregnancy and so on.

 

With about 90% of water content, just a few calories, almost no fat and high fiber along with a horde of nutrients it’s definitely a goldmine amongst the vegetable category.

 

 

Let’s look into the 10 Health Benefits of Bottle Gourd / Doodhi in Detail

 

1. Doodhi is Low in Calories and Fat.

Can be Savoured by Weight Watcher’sDoodhi or Bottle Gourd must be added to a weight watcher’s diet once a week for sure. A cup of chopped bottle gourd endows just about 17 calories and 0.1 g of fat. In addition it has 2.9 g of fiber too, which fills your stomach, digests slowly aids in weight loss.

2. Doodhi filled with 90% of Water.

A Perfect Thirst Quencher & Summer Delight – It’s a great idea to have a glass of Doodhi juice in summers. It reduces body heat and helps to quench thirst. By replenishing the much needed water content in your body, it will re-energize your body and prevent further fatigue.

3. Lauki is Low in Carbs. Suitable For Diabetics

Being filled with so much water, doodhi is not only low in carbs (3.6 gm per cup) but also shows up in the list of low glycemic index foods.

Diabetics can safely add it to their pantry and be assured of no fluctuations in their blood sugar levels.

4. Lauki Low in Sodium.  Extremely beneficial for Hypertension & Heart

With extremely low levels of sodium, this vegetable is highly suitable for those with high BP. It helps reduce blood cholesterol levels and regulate blood pressure and ensures a proper blood flow to heart and there onwards to all parts of the body.

5. Doodhi is Alkaline in Nature.  Befriend it if You suffer from Acidity often

Acidity is one such disease which can be controlled on a day-to-day basis with the perfect selection of ingredients. Bottle gourd is one of them.

It’s alkalinity proves to be beneficial for the gut. A glass of bottle gourd juice eases the acids of the stomach and provides relief from acidity symptoms. It helps prevent acidity too.

6. Doodhi is High in vitamin C.  Carries Skin Glowing Properties

The high antioxidant vitamin C content of doodhi helps reduce wrinkles and induces a charming and smooth skin.

Not only adding this vegetable to your meal helps, but fresh doodhi juice applied to the face and left for 20 minutes also shows instant glow on your skin. Try it and you will feel absolutely fresh and rejuvenated. Merely remember to consume the juice immediately, as it oxidizes very fast and has a tendency of reducing the vitamin C concentration.

 

 

7. Doodhi is Loaded with Water.  Contributes Towards Easing Diarrhea

When solid food cannot be digested and you need a perfect glass to restore your water and electrolyte ratio, turn to this vegetable.

Drink a glass of this juice with a pinch of salt - it’s quite pleasing to your gut and stomach.

 

 

8. Doodhi is High in Fiber.  Treats Constipation

Beneficial to the gut is the high fiber content of bottle gourd. Along with its high water content, this vegetable will provide bulk to stools and ease bowel movements.

9. Doodhi is Established as an Alkaline Vegetable.  It’s a Home Remedy for Urinary Infection

The best way to treat urinary infection is to offer your body with water from different sources. This water filled vegetable is a perfect choice then. Bottle Gourd Juice encompasses the alkalinity which helps to flush out toxins by way of urine when combined with some lemon juice.

10. Bottle gourd is  Rich in Antioxidant.  Reduces Inflammation of Liver

When liver is inflamed and needs that perfect nutrition to recover, bottle being high in antioxidant vitamin C is usually suggested.

Again a glass of its juice would provide the utmost benefit.

 


Did You Know What’s Bottle Gourd Known as Across India?

Hindi – Lauki / Kaddu

Gujarati – Doodhi

Marathi – Pandhara Bhopla

Bengali – Lau

Tamil – Surai Kai

Telugu – Sorrakaye

Malayalam – Charanga

Kannada - Sorekai

Punjabi – Ghia

Nutritional Information of Bottle Gourd (Doodhi, lauki)

1 Cup of chopped bottle gourd is about 145 grams
RDA stands for Recommended Daily Allowance.

Energy - 17 calories
Protein – 0.3 g
Carbohydrate – 3.6 g
Fat – 0.1 g
Fiber – 2.9 g
